AceShowbiz - "So You Think You Can Dance" is finally back with its original format, after shaking things up in 2015 with the lackluster "Stage Vs. Street" theme and introducing "SYTYCD Jr." in 2016. "SYTYCD" kicked off its season 14 on Monday, June 12, featuring new judge Vanessa Hudgens as well as bringing back judge Mary Murphy. The new season began with the first round of auditions in Los Angeles, where contestants competed for a spot at The Academy callbacks.

First up was Mark Villaver, 26, from Hawaii. Performing a breaking contemporary, he managed to make the crowd be quiet with awe. He mixed contemporary with breaking to create a truly unique experience. Judge Nigel Lythgoe said that he was remarkable and dubbed him "sensational." Vanessa loved his performance and praised him for being a "strong, talented and creative" dancer. Mark went straight through to The Academy.

Kristina and Vasily later hit the stage. The married couple did a ballroom routine so beautifully with Vasily being blindfolded. Despite not being able to see, Vasily danced effortlessly and the couple even shared a sweet kiss while Vasily span Kristina off the ground. "That's the first time I've ever cried over a ballroom routine in the history of this show," said Mary. Kristina and Vasily won the ticket to The Academy.

Robert Green, 24, from North Carolina was up next. Donning intriguing outfit, Robert danced to either animation or pop n lock. His performance was so much fun, making the crowd go wild. Nigel called him "a dancing sandwich." Robert made it to the next round.

Robert's performance was followed by Alexis, 22, from Riverside. Although she said she hadn't slept all week, she nailed her jazz routine. Vanessa thought she had energy. Alexis went to The Academy.

Luke Dryjski, 29, from Tampa later hit the stage. Although he said that he had been dancing for years and was a trained hip hop dancer, he failed to impress the judges. Nigel cut his performance midway. Unfortunately, Luke had to go back to Tampa.

Darius Hickman, 18, from Florida performed a dramatic difficult dance. He said that dancing was his way to get through his life as he was abused since 4. All the judges said no words but gave him a standing ovation with golden ticket in hand. Darius went straight to The Academy.

Rounding out the night were Russian identical twins, Anastasia and Viktoria. The siblings danced to a modern dance. The girls got a standing ovation from the judges. Nigel called it "brilliant entertainment, and beautifully executed." Meanwhile, Mary said it was one of the most unique auditions she's ever seen, and it made her cry. However, Nigel said in an interview that the twins never made it to Academy due to Visa problems.
